How they compare
Cambodia currently reports 10.0% against 9.9% in Switzerland, a difference of 0.1%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 11 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Switzerland ahead.
Cambodia ranks 97th and Switzerland ranks 99th of 144 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Cambodia averaged higher in 1 and Switzerland in 5.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cambodia | Switzerland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 1.2% | 7.5% | 6.3% | Switzerland |
| 1970s | 2.3% | 9.8% | 7.6% | Switzerland |
| 1980s | 5.5% | 11.4% | 5.9% | Switzerland |
| 1990s | 8.0% | 10.4% | 2.5% | Switzerland |
| 2000s | 7.6% | 8.8% | 1.2% | Switzerland |
| 2010s | 10.0% | 9.9% | 0.1% | Cambodia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
